    Our client, a Bay Area headquartered Commercial Real Estate Investment and Management Company with a portfolio of industrial and mixed use properties leased to large Fortune 500 companies, needs a strong, financial minded Commercial Property Manager for a property with active facilities and space management.

    Job Description The Commercial Property Manager manages the building operations and property management team members ensuring the fiscal and operational success of the building.

    With excellent analytical skills, the primary responsibility of the Commercial Property Manager will be the financial management and reporting for the property working closely with the accounting team and building ownership.

    With excellent customer service skills, the Commercial Property Manager will work with tenants and building team members to support the property retention goals.

    Strong team work and accountability are key attributes of the successful Property Manager.
